C'mon the Lions know they are playing down to the competition but if playing down to the opposition leads you to a 11-4 record with one game to play let it be. The Detroit Lions carrying that #20 Barry Sanders Jersey with them squeaks out another ugly "W" 20-14 over the Jimmy Clausen led Bears.

The Lions dug deep as the Bears went into the 4th with a 14-10 lead after Clausen hooked up with Bears WR Alshon Jeffery for a 14-yard TD on a fourteen play 80 yard drive. It was the Lions answering back though with a quick four play 73 yard drive with a Joique Bell slick 17-yard TD run making it 17-14 Lions. Lions added a FG and that was your ball game Lions lead the NFC North beating the Bears 20-14 with a date with the Packers in Lambeau in Week 17.

Lions QB Matthew Stafford was 22 for 39 for 243 yards and two INT's. It was Lions running backs Joique Bell and Reggie Bush combining for 128 yards on twenty carries and two TD's. MEGAtron grabbed six pigs for 103 yards with Golden Tate III 62 yards on five grabs.

The Bears falling to 5-10 gets a solid performance from Jimmy Clausen as he was 23 for 39 for 181 yards two TD's and an INT. Matt Forte ran for 55 yard on 19 carries with WR Alshon Jeffery grabbing six pigs for 72 yards and a score. It came down to the Bears "D" making a stop and at this point they couldn't stop any of the 31 NFL Teams offenses!

Lions @ Packers for the NFC North Title next week in Lambeau...
